Brighton & Hove Albion vs. Liverpool Livestream: How to Watch FA Cup Soccer From Anywhere

An all Premier League fixture at the Amex Stadium sees the Seagulls looking to inflict their second defeat on the Reds in a month.

Having played them off the park in their recent English Premier League meeting at Anfield, Brighton will be hoping to inflict another demoralizing defeat on Liverpool in this FA Cup fourth round clash.

The Seagulls waltzed to a comfortable 0-3 away victory in that match earlier this month, thanks to a Solly March double and a Danny Welbeck strike, in a performance which illustrated the relentless attacking philosophy of new coach Roberto De Zerbi.

Unbeaten in their last four and currently sitting sixth in the table, Brighton are on the up and will fancy their chances here against a Liverpool side that are struggling to live up to their Premier League heavyweight status.

The visitors head into this fixture with just one win in their last five across all competitions, with coach Jurgen Klopp desperately trying to revitalize a side that has been lackluster in front of goal since the World Cup break.

Brighton vs. Liverpool: When and where?

Brighton host Liverpool at the Amex Stadium on Sunday, Jan. 29. Kickoff is set for 1.30 p.m. local time in the UK (8.30 a.m. ET, 5.30 p.m. PT in the US and Canada, and 12.30 a.m. AEDT on Jan. 30 in Australia).

Livestream the Brighton vs. Liverpool game in the US

This cup match at the Amex Stadium is streaming exclusively live in the US on ESPN Plus. Kickoff is at 8.30 a.m. ET (5.30 a.m. PT) on Sunday morning for viewers in the States.

Livestream the Brighton vs. Liverpool game for free in the UK

The great news for footy fans in the UK is that free-to air broadcasters the BBC and ITV are sharing live duties for this season’s FA Cup.

This fixture is being shown exclusively on ITV1, with coverage starting at 12:45 p.m. GMT ahead of the 1.30 p.m. kick-off.

Livestream Brighton vs. Liverpool game in Canada

Canadian soccer fans looking to watch this big FA Cup fixture can watch all the action live via Sportsnet, with kickoff set for 8.30 a.m. ET (5.30 a.m. PT) on Sunday morning.

Livestream Brighton vs. Liverpool game in Australia

ViacomCBS now holds the broadcast rights for the FA Cup in Australia, which means you can now watch matches from the tournament live Down Under via streaming service Paramount Plus. Kickoff is at the somewhat inconvenient time of 12.30 a.m. AEDT early Monday morning.
